One of the most critical aspects of their work involves identifying and mitigating potential risks associated with concrete damage. Concrete is susceptible to various deteriorations, such as cracking, spalling, and erosion, which can compromise structural integrity. Licensed engineers are equipped with advanced knowledge in materials science and construction methods to predict these issues. They incorporate this understanding into every project, designing structures that withstand the test of time and environmental factors.
